      He said the main problem with the CFI's are electrical connections and vacume leaks... due to all of the connections.... (Anyone with the CHI knows what I mean!) So he always starts by replacing all of the vacume lines, and cleaning all of the electrical plugs with a small brush and electrical contact cleaner spray, until they are clean and shiny he said... He also removes the injectors and cleans them... Not sure how he does that tho... If he takes them apart or soaks them....
